Re: Bug#542865: Grant an FHS exception for the multiarch library directories
On Fri, Aug 21 2009, Russ Allbery wrote:
> Steve Langasek <vorlon@debian.org> writes:
>> On Fri, Aug 21, 2009 at 03:47:24PM -0700, Russ Allbery wrote:
>
>>> It looks good to me as a first step. Seconded, with the caveat that we
>>> probably don't want to release this with Policy until we've hammered
>>> out any specific restrictions on how those directories can be used
>>> first.
>
>> I think the only specific restriction needed is already spelled out -
>> that packages can only install to the triplet matching their own
>> architecture. Are there other restrictions that you think are called
>> for?
>
> The current restriction is specific to libraries. Don't we need to say
> that you can't put *any* files into any triplet directory that isn't for
> your package architecture?
Hmm. My first read was that one could not put anything that was
not a library in these directories, but perhaps it should be stated
explicitly.
